Output 66f1a78966005bdea07e90de7250aa5bd1514292df0a8ab79103125878d642e6:0

value
58561
script pubkey
OP_HASH160 OP_PUSHBYTES_20 60da7289b00cbc74e2975841ecb1e673c382b8b2 OP_EQUAL
address
3AX8UxAGiuVzrkRTA8qjRwhMyaXyc5wtKX
transaction
66f1a78966005bdea07e90de7250aa5bd1514292df0a8ab79103125878d642e6
spent
true